site stats

React hook window resize

WebDec 26, 2024 · useWindowWidth React Hook Raw useWindowWidth.js import { useEffect, useState } from 'react'; import debounce from 'lodash/debounce'; function useWindowWidth (delay = 700) { const [width, setWidth] = useState (window.innerWidth); useEffect ( () => { const handleResize = () => setWidth (window.innerWidth); WebOct 26, 2024 · How to Use React Hooks to Detect Window Size in React Js Step 1: Create React Project Step 2: Create Component File Step 3: Get Dynamic Screen Dimension on …

React Hook - Only listen to window *width* size change

WebJun 12, 2024 · When the window is resized, the callback will be called and the windowSize state will be updated with the current window dimensions. To get that, we set the width to window.innerWidth, and height, window.innerHeight. Adding SSR support However, the code as we have it here will not work. WebFeb 21, 2024 · Custom React Hooks are a great tool that we can use to extract component logic into easily reusable functions. Let’s do this now and use the window resizing logic … song i walk with god https://boldnraw.com

10 Clever Custom React Hooks You Need to Know About

WebA React hook that allows you to use a ResizeObserver to measure an element's size. Highlights Written in TypeScript. Tiny: 648B (minified, gzipped) Monitored by size-limit. Exposes an onResize callback if you need more control. box option. Works with SSR. Works with CSS-in-JS. Supports custom refs in case you had one already. WebNov 12, 2024 · Draggable And Resizable Panel With React Hooks. Part 1. In this part we will create a panel that can be freely dragged with react and react hooks. I’ve created a new react app using npx... smallest city in belgium

Resize event listener using React hooks - DEV Community

Category:Developing responsive layouts with React Hooks

Tags:React hook window resize

React hook window resize

デザイナーが抱くReact+TypeScriptの疑問を紐解き、フロントエ …

WebApr 14, 2024 · Hook 8. useWindowSize import { useState, useEffect } from 'react' const useWindowSize = (): { width: number; height: number } => { const [windowSize, setWindowSize] = useState ( { width:... WebApr 10, 2024 · デザイナーが抱くReact+TypeScriptの疑問を紐解き、フロントエンドに一歩近づこう. こんにちは。. ひらやま( @rhirayamaaan )です。. 先日とあるツイートを見かけ、つい反応してしまいました。. これはReactコンポーネントを作る時に最低限必要なTypeScriptの知識を ...

React hook window resize

Did you know?

WebAug 2, 2024 · 1 React.useEffect(() => { 2 window.addEventListener("resize", updateWidthAndHeight); 3 return () => window.removeEventListener("resize", … WebuseElementSize. () This hook helps you to dynamically recover the width and the height of an HTML element. Dimensions are updated on load, on mount/un-mount, when resizing …

WebAug 23, 2024 · A user might click a button or resize a window. The browser might receive a message from a server or worker process. An event listener is set up when we write code that defines the kind of event that might occur and the code that should run when that event is eventually detected. WebEasily retrieve window dimensions with this React Hook which also works onResize. The Hook 1import { useState } from 'react' 2 3import { useEventListener, useIsomorphicLayoutEffect } from 'usehooks-ts' 4 5interface WindowSize { 6 width: number 7 height: number 8} 9 10function useWindowSize(): WindowSize {

WebApr 15, 2024 · In #React and #ReactNative, #hooks are a powerful feature that allows developers to use state and other React features in functional components without having to use class components or render props. WebEasily retrieve window dimensions with this React Hook which also works onResize. The Hook 1import { useState } from 'react' 2 3import { useEventListener, …

WebJan 9, 2024 · window.addEventListener('resize', function() { // your custom logic }); This one can be used successfully, but it is not looking very good in a React app. So I decided to …

WebApr 10, 2024 · After debouncing the window resize event handler: Hook for calling a method after the browser is done resizing. While we’re here, let’s do some cleanup and move all the handlers, useEffect hooks, and other hooks from the NavigationLink.tsx into a wrapping hook so that it is clear that all those methods and hooks are meant to support the ... smallest city in california by populationWebBasic Usage: import { useState } from 'react'; import useWindowResize from 'beautiful-react-hooks/useWindowResize'; const WindowSizeReporter = () => { const [width, setWidth] = … smallest city in chileWebJul 2, 2024 · import "twin.macro" import { Global, css } from "@emotion/core" import { useState, useEffect } from "react" const Navbar = () => { const useWindowDimensions = () => { const hasWindow = typeof window !== "undefined" function getWindowDimensions () { const width = hasWindow ? window.innerWidth : null const height = hasWindow ? … smallest city in australiaWebReact hooks for updating components when the size of the `window` changes.. Latest version: 3.1.1, last published: 7 months ago. Start using @react-hook/window-size in your … song i wanna dance with somebodyWebreact-hook Strongly typed React hooks for function components Note on IE11 If you need support for legacy browsers you will have to do what you should be doing already anyway and compile your dependencies to your desired target. This library does not ship transformations for browsers the maintainer doesn't care about performing maintenance … smallest city in bcWebA React hook that allows you to use a ResizeObserver to measure an element's size. Highlights Written in TypeScript. Tiny: 648B(minified, gzipped) Monitored by size-limit. Exposes an onResize callbackif you need more control. boxoption. Works with SSR. Works with CSS-in-JS. Supports custom refsin case you had one already. song i wanna be with you by the raspberriesWebJun 12, 2024 · To find out the window width and height, we can add an event listener and listen for the resize event. And whenever the browser sizes change, we can update a … smallest city in each state